Analysis

In 2023, prevalence of undernourishment in South Asia stood at 11.7%.

That represents a change of down 10.0% on the previous year and down 10.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, prevalence of undernourishment in South Asia peaked at 20.8% in 2004 and was at its lowest, 10.5%, in 2018.

South Asia ranks 18th of 47 groups on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 23 years of available data.

Prevalence of undernourishment in South Asia, year by year

Annual values for Prevalence of undernourishment (% of population) in South Asia, 2001 to 2023.
Year % of population Change
2001 17.9%
2002 19.1% +6.9%
2003 20.4% +6.6%
2004 20.8% +1.8%
2005 20.3% -2.4%
2006 18.4% -9.3%
2007 16.4% -10.6%
2008 15.4% -6.6%
2009 15.2% -1.2%
2010 14.9% -2.1%
2011 14.5% -2.6%
2012 13.7% -5.4%
2013 13.1% -4.4%
2014 12.7% -2.6%
2015 12.2% -4.0%
2016 11.7% -4.4%
2017 10.7% -8.3%
2018 10.5% -2.2%
2019 11.5% +9.5%
2020 12.8% +12.0%
2021 13.6% +5.8%
2022 13.0% -4.7%
2023 11.7% -10.0%

Prevalence of undernourishment is the percentage of the population whose habitual food consumption is insufficient to provide the dietary energy levels that are required to maintain a normal active and healthy life. Data showing as 2.5 may signify a prevalence of undernourishment below 2.5%.
